Table 3-2. Over-Temperature Switch Controls and Indicators

CONTROL or

INDICATOR

MEANING

FUNCTION

LED Display

TEMP status

Displays current water temperature or setpoint.

RST

RESET Button

Resets the unit after an alarm condition.

UP Button

Increases the displayed temperature.

DOWN Button

Decreases the displayed temperature.

SET

SET Button

Used to access and store parameters in the unit.

3.3.3 Over-Temperature Switch Sensor Adjustment

The Over-Temperature Switch can be adjusted to allow a ±10°F offset, in order to match the
value from a Eurotherm Temperature Controller. To use this function, complete the following
steps:

1) Press and hold the SET button for 8 to 12 seconds. The display will show 00. DO NOT

change these values.

2) Momentarily press the SET button. The SP parameter will be displayed.

3) Using the Up and Down arrow keys, scroll to parameter P1.

4) Press the SET button. The display will show the current offset (default = 0).

5) Press the Up and Down arrows to enter the desired offset value (-10 to +10°).

6) Press the SET button to store the selected offset value.

7) Press the SET and Down arrow buttons at the same time to quit the programming mode, or

wait one minute and the display will automatically exit the programming mode.
